A lot of beginning real estate investors never realize success, because they mismanage their repairs. They don’t leave themselves enough money to handle all of the repairs needed, which compromised their position. In fact, their properties often become the next investment purchase of another investor. Darrick made a lot of good suggestions. For instance, one way of getting a good painter is to go to the paint store, not just a general store, like Home Depot or Lowe’s. He also reminded us to negotiate to board up your vacant home if your home is in a rough neighborhood. A lot of investors like to save money by avoiding this last step, but after one break-in, you will pay more in damages than if you just paid to board up the property in the first place. He also suggested that if you are in a bad neighborhood, pay for security, and get a long-term contract. If the home is empty, it will slow down, if not fully stop, thieves. It is something that you can use as a selling point to incoming renters. Plus, it helps to continue to protect your property.
